Position: Data Scientist with Security Clearance
Role:
Data Scientist Clearance: TS/SCI Clearance

Location:

(Washington DC / Northern Virginia)
Salary: $160k-$200k + Shares and bonus My client is an innovative company delivering cutting-edge AI and data analytics solutions through an advanced AI platform. They are currently seeking a Data Scientist with an active TS/SCI security clearance to join their growing Platform team.

This role offers significant career growth opportunities for those aiming to progress into Lead Data Scientist or Team Manager positions. Responsibilities:
Leverage the capabilities of my client’s AI platform to design and deploy production-level AI solutions for customers.
Take ownership of customer data workflows—from ideation through to deployment of AI models in real-world environments.
Utilize integrations with large-scale data platforms (e.g., Databricks) to build scalable solutions as needed. Requirements:
Active TS/SCI security clearance and willingness to work in a SCIF when required.
Reside in or near Washington DC / Northern Virginia to access relevant secure facilities.
Open to regular travel to client locations and military installations.
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science (or related field).
3+ years of experience writing production-grade Python code.
3+ years of hands-on experience with core Python data libraries (e.g., pandas, numpy, sklearn, tensor flow, pytorch, matplotlib).
At least 1 year of experience deploying machine learning models in production environments.
1–2 years of experience working with SQL/No

SQL databases (e.g., Elasticsearch, graph databases).
3 years of experience using Git or similar version control systems.
At least 1 year of experience with Docker and/or Kubernetes.
Strong sense of ownership and accountability.
Excellent communication skills in English, both written and verbal. Nice-to-Haves:
Demonstrated experience leading project development efforts from a SCIF.
Familiarity with cybersecurity analytics, including PCAP, CVEs, and network monitoring.
Experience integrating with technologies such as Spark, Dask, Snowpark, or Kafka.
Background in web application stacks (e.g., Flask, Django) or task schedulers (e.g., Airflow, Celery, Prefect). Compensation & Benefits:
Competitive salary, equity, and performance-based bonus.
Full benefits package including medical, dental, and vision.
